What Does 25kg Equal in Pounds?
Basic Conversion Formula
The fundamental conversion between kilograms and pounds relies on a fixed ratio. One kilogram is approximately equal to 2.20462 pounds. Therefore, to convert 25kg to pounds, you multiply 25 by this conversion factor: 25 kg × 2.20462 = ? lb Calculating this: 25 × 2.20462 = 55.1155 lb So, 25kg is approximately 55.12 pounds.Exact Conversion and Rounding
Depending on the level of precision required, you can round this number:- Rounded to the nearest whole number: 55 lb
- Rounded to two decimal places: 55.12 lb Most practical applications, such as luggage weight limits or dietary measurements, use rounded figures for simplicity.

Understanding the Conversion: Why 2.20462?
The History of the Pound and Kilogram
The pound has roots in ancient measurement systems, originating from Roman and Anglo-Saxon units. It was historically based on a physical object—the "pound" of a certain commodity. The kilogram, introduced as part of the metric system in the late 18th century, is now defined by a physical constant. The current international standard for the kilogram is based on the Planck constant, making it a precise and universal unit. The pound, however, remains a customary unit in some countries.The Conversion Constant
The value 2.20462 is derived from the definition: 1 kilogram = 2.2046226218 pounds This value is used worldwide as the standard conversion factor.Practical Applications of Converting 25kg to lb
